Just how many People Sign up for the Three-Go out Rule?

Just how many when you look at the-individual schedules do you really want with a brand new lover in advance of with sex thereupon individual? We often learn about the newest very-called three-big date rule, or even the proven fact that the 3rd big date ‘s the right for you personally to start with sex. However, so is this extremely good rule that people pursue?

Inside the a recently available demographically user survey out-of dos,2 hundred Americans held from the Kinsey Institute and you may Lovehoney, i asked that it matter-of single people and you can daters and you will what we found are there is a number of variability!

Within the studying the total studies, three times is the new average (50th percentile) reaction. In other words, it was the stage where 50% have been significantly more than and you may 50% was in fact lower than-it is inside the midst of the fresh new effect assortment. Medians are usually way more educational to consider than simply averages since averages are inclined to distortion when you yourself have some extreme responses.

Eg, for people who search alternatively at average amount of schedules people wished, it absolutely was closer to twelve; yet not, more 91% of individuals chosen several lower than twelve. The average is really skewed in this case due to the fact a few men and women reported interested in around step one,000 schedules. This is certainly the ultimate example of why averages will likely be misleading and exactly why it’s always worthy of taking a look at the average, too.

Statistics lessons aside, if you find yourself three times try the fresh average, simply 21% in fact asserted that this is the amount of times they might desire prior to sex. Actually, 38% was comfortable with fewer than three dates, while 41% prominent more about three times. In other words, cuatro within the 5 people do not frequently follow the latest three-date laws. Here is the review of the overall number:

  • 8% told you zero schedules was basically requisite just before sex
  • 17% said you to definitely day
  • 14% said a couple times
  • 21% told you around three dates
  • 8% told you five schedules
  • 11% said five schedules
  • 13% said between half a dozen and you can 10 schedules
  • 9% told you 10 or higher dates (and you will, as i mentioned above, the product range went completely doing step 1,000 dates)

Needless to say, the newest amounts perform are different a bit when you crack them down of the demographic groups. Instance, across the sexual orientations, almost half dudes stated looking for less than step three schedules, while you are below one-3rd of women said a similar. The actual only real differences all over sexual orientations are that asexual people advertised trying to find the absolute most times on average.

Those types of which defined as transgender, its solutions to that concern have been like the ones from self-recognized dudes (we.age., it common less times typically). Some of those whom identified as low-binary, its responses was in fact similar to that from mind-understood female (we.age., it popular a lot more schedules normally). Yet not, contained in this for each and every class, you will find plenty of type.

There is and quite a bit of variability round the age. Like, more youthful people wished a lot more dates than the elderly. Remember that this range for this shot are 18-forty five, so the studies you should never consult with fashion past that it. not, it had been the new 18-24 group you to definitely desired more times. Particularly, while merely 1 in step three 18-24 year-olds was indeed comfortable with sex up until the third day, the quantity jumped to almost 1 / 2 of having thirty-five-45 12 months-olds.

In addition, there are variations according to competition and ethnicity, with African Us citizens getting more comfortable with fewer dates, Far eastern People in america preferring alot more dates, or other organizations being in anywhere between. There are also variations according to socioeconomic position, where a great bimodal impression came up: men and women at reduced and you may high income accounts prominent a lot fewer schedules, if you are those with revenue between popular a lot more dates.

Finally, there have been together with distinctions considering COVID vaccination reputation. This new communities preferred that have fewer dates in advance of sex was basically the fresh folks who was basically unvaccinated and don’t require this new vaccine, also those who have been fully vaccinated. Unvaccinated people who require brand new vaccine but have not received it as well because the people that was indeed partly vaccinated well-known a lot more dates.

You to maximum of these info is you to, definitely, the audience is speaking essentially. You will be able (and you will likely) that folks get follow various other criteria in almost any factors, based on what they are selecting during the time together with vibrant they have to the other individual.

But not, having said that, just what a few of these results strongly recommend is that there isn’t a common simple here. Yes, about three times is the unmarried most frequent metric people appear to explore for choosing the appropriate time to has sex-but the bulk do not subscribe to they.

This implies there isn’t that right time for you initiate with sex with a new partner that works for all. kissbridesdate.com buen sitio It’s eventually on which you are more comfortable with, thus don’t get hung up with the particular random laws!

It’s also well worth noting you to browse discovers that timing off sex is a highly weak predictor off relationship effects. This means that, it will most likely not make or break the connection if you have sex fundamentally rather than after. So which is a new cause to stop providing fixated on this subject.
